ADVANCED GLASS MARKET SEGMENTATION
By Type
Based on Type, the global market can be categorized into Laminated Glass, Coated Glass, Toughened Glass, and Others
- Laminated Glass Laminated glass is bonded together with an interlayer consisting of multiple layers, which provides higher safety and strength. It is used in automobile windshields and architectural applications because it shatters less than other types of glass. Even when broken, the glass stays intact, and this reduces the possibility of injury while enhancing security.
- Coated Glass Coated glass is used for a thin layer of metal or chemical coating that improves the thermal insulation, UV protection, or glare reduction. It is extensively used in energy-efficient buildings, automobiles, and electronic displays. This kind of glass helps improve energy savings by controlling the transmission of heat and reducing artificial cooling or heating.
- Toughened Glass Tempered glass, often referred to as toughened glass, is heat-treatment given to increase its strength and resist impact better. Its use is widespread in construction, automotive, and consumer electronics, but it is incredibly useful because it breaks into smaller, less damaging pieces when hit. The glass is very resistant to possible damage, offering ideal safety-critical applications for doors, windows, and screens on mobile devices.
By Application
Based on application, the global market can be categorized into Safety & Security, Solar Control, Optics & Lighting, High Performance, and Others
- Safety & Security Advanced glass will have the effects of impacts, breakages, and attempted entry. Common applications include automotive windshields, bank security windows, and high-risk building structures. Such glass maximizes occupant protection in a minimally injured and better-structured skeleton form.
- Solar Control The solar control glass controls the flow of heat and light. This reduces energy consumption in buildings and vehicles. It is widely used in green buildings, automotive sunroofs, as well as commercial space to enhance the indoor comfort level. The glass reduces glare and UV radiation, which prevents furniture from fading.
- Optics & Lighting Advanced glass in optics and lighting applications ensures high transparency, light diffusion, and optical clarity. This glass is applied in lenses, LED displays, and high-performance lighting systems for efficiency and better visibility. The glass helps enhance brightness while reducing energy loss and visual distortions.
- High Performance High-performance glass offers the ultimate combinations of thermal insulating and damping capabilities along with superior strength as well as durable resistance to high-energy applications like skyscrapers, luxury autos, and spacecraft. This class of glass gives significant benefits when it comes to reducing carbon footprint and enhancing internal environmental quality towards sustainability.

KEY INDUSTRY DEVELOPMENTS
October 2024: One industrial development in the Advanced Glass Market is announced by Saint-Gobain. They launched the new generation electrochromic glass, SageGlass Harmony IQ, focused on optimizing energy efficiency and comfort for commercial buildings' occupants. This novel glass offers dynamic light modulation by effortlessly switching between a clear and tinted state for optimal natural lighting and thermal performance. Additionally, it is integrable with building management systems for intelligent control to reduce energy consumption by as much as 20%. The development shows that the group is putting much emphasis on smart building solutions and sustainability, cementing Saint-Gobain's leadership in advanced glass technology.
